What Price Glory. Directed by John Ford, produced by Sol C. Siegel, screenplay by Phoebe and Henry Ephron, based on the 1924 play What Price Glory? by Laurence Stallings and Maxwell Anderson, cinematography by Joseph MacDonald as "Joe MacDonald", film editing by Dorothy Spencer, music by Alfred Newman, Twentieth Century Fox, USA, 1952, soundtrack: English/French, Mono, 35mm, aspect ratio: 1.37:1, color (Technicolor), 110 min.
Cast: James Cagney (Captain Flagg), Corinne Calvet (Charmaine), Dan Dailey (First Sergeant Quirt), William Demarest (Corporal Kiper), Craig Hill (Lieutenant Aldrich), Robert Wagner (Private Lewisohn), Marisa Pavan (Nicole Bouchard), Max Showalter as "Casey Adams" (Lieutenant Moore), James Gleason (General Cokely), Wally Vernon (Lipinsky), Henri Letondal (Cognac Pete, Charmaine’s father)
